Miyagi, Japan— A fresh, complex orange wine made from the hybrid grape Delaware. Floral and fruity nose, hazy citrus, tangerine, apricot, ginger, and a hint of cinnamon on the palate. A touch of volatile acidity plays nicely with the creaminess from the lees aging. Delaware grapes from four contract farms in Yamagata were macerated from 19 to 63 days. Fermentation in barrels, amphorae and resin tanks, with everything blended in stainless steel tanks after 4 to 5 months on the lees. No s02. 

Fattoria AL FIORE began in 2005 as an Italian restaurant in Sendai, founded by chef Hirotaka Meguro, who prioritized local, seasonal ingredients. His deepening connection to agriculture led him to witness Japan’s rural decline, inspiring him to shift from cooking to winemaking as a way to preserve local traditions. In 2014, he planted vineyards on abandoned farmland in Miyagi, and, by 2018, he and his partner Reina had transformed a closed elementary school gym into a winery built with local materials and traditional Japanese craftsmanship. Farming 2.3 hectares at the foot of the Zao  mountains, they grow a diverse mix of grapes— including Merlot, Gewürztraminer, and Pinot Noir— using organic, regenerative methods, rain shelters, and careful vinetraining to combat Japan’s humidity. Their wine, wild-fermented and aged in amphorae, oak, and stainless steel, are crafted with zero sulfur and bottled by hand with washi labels and wax seals, reflecting a deep respect for natural winemaking and Japan’s culinary heritage.
